TODD CHAFFEE
Managing Director at IVP
ActiveInvestor
Updated: ·
About
Todd Chaffee is Managing Director at IVP.
Experience
Frequently Asked Questions
Who is Todd Chaffee?
Todd Chaffee is Managing Director at IVP.
Managing Director at IVP
Todd Chaffee is Managing Director at IVP.
Todd Chaffee is Managing Director at IVP.